Consumer Loan Collection Manager jobs in Ann Arbor, MI

Consumer Loan Collection Manager manages a group of collection supervisors and develops collection strategies to minimize collection portfolio loss. Responsible for initial and ongoing training of all subordinate personnel. Being a Consumer Loan Collection Manager requ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a top management. The Consumer Loan Collection Manager typ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Consumer Loan Collection Manager typ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Who You Are


    The Commercial Loan Documentation Specialist is responsible for the preparation and documentation for post-closing activities related to consumer loans for Home Equity, lines of credit and installment loans. 


    Your Role

      

    1. Create and deliver accurate loan documentation in a timely manner while ensuring that the final package correctly incorporates the terms of the credit approval document, as well as internal and regulatory credit and policy standards. 

    2. Provide accurate boarding data information to the Loan Operations Group to ensure the integrity of our loan accounting system. 

    3. Post close all consumer loans including completing post-closing checklists, preparing and sending completed documentation and post-closing correspondence to customer, preparing tickets, cashier’s checks and wire transfer forms

    4. Reviews necessary documents, such as title searches and / or UCC’s to ensure BOAA’s security position for collateral and repayment.

    5. Completes follow up work to ensure the perfection of BOAA’s collateral position, including sending in mortgages and the necessary payments.

    6. Looks regularly at reporting of paid off loans to ensure that the necessary steps are taken to release collateral and return documentation to the borrower within stated regulatory guidelines.

    7. Complete the Consumer Loan Formula report on a weekly basis, or more often depending on changing market conditions.

    8. Monitor the status of hazard insurance on all consumer loans, which will require frequent communication with agencies and the borrower to ensure that the Bank’s collateral position is properly protected. If necessary, this individual will have to work to issue the necessary paperwork to force place insurance if the client is not responsive. 

    9. Monitor past due consumer loans; working with Loan Officers and contacting clients as necessary to collect payments.

    10. Work with the VP Consumer Loans to monitor changes in FEMA flood plains and administer changes to flood certificates for commercial, consumer and residential loans. Review, add and remove Flood insurance when necessary. 

    11. Responsible for the consumer loans in the director scanning system.

    12. Preparation of committee minutes for consumer and residential mortgage loans.

    13. Perform subordination agreement documentation, any BOAA consumer loans

Ann Arbor is a city in the U.S. state of Michigan and the county seat of Washtenaw County. The 2010 census recorded its population to be 113,934, making it the sixth largest city in Michigan. Ann Arbor is home to the University of Michigan. The university significantly shapes Ann Arbor's economy as it employs about 30,000 workers, including about 12,000 in the medical center. The city's economy is also centered on high technology, with several companies drawn to the area by the university's research and development infrastructure.
